The SPI80N06S-08 belongs to the category of power MOSFETs.
It is used as a switching device in various electronic circuits and power applications.
The SPI80N06S-08 is typically available in a TO-220 package.
This product is essential for efficient power management and control in electronic systems.
It is commonly packaged in reels or tubes, with quantities varying based on manufacturer specifications.
The SPI80N06S-08 has three pins: 1. Gate (G) 2. Drain (D) 3. Source (S)
The SPI80N06S-08 operates based on the principle of field-effect transistors, where the application of a voltage at the gate terminal controls the flow of current between the drain and source terminals.
The SPI80N06S-08 is widely used in: - Motor control systems - Power supplies - Inverters - Switched-mode power supplies - Automotive electronic systems
